Together Forever

We said "I do" forever,
Promised, to part never,
Our bond was true,
With both me and you.

We stuck it out,
There was no doubt,
We built our life together
Our love will be forever.

We faced our struggles, 
We weren’t a perfect couple,
We worked it out,
That’s what it was all about.

In little things we found joy,
Holding hands does not annoy,
Our love grows deeper,
We both know I’ll keep her.

Life we know is never fair,
So, we promised to always be there,
For each other, through thick and thin,
Together forever, until the end.
